Пластина Fleаxwear с адгезивной окантовкой производства компании Hollister (Холлистер), США, позволяет максимально эффективно использовать двухкомпонентные системы Холлистер, предназначенные для пациентов с уростомами, колостомами, а также илеостомами. Надежность крепления обеспечивается добавочной адгезивной окантовкой, выполненной из уникального гидроколлоидного материала. Пластина легко адаптируется к неровностям поверхности кожи и может с успехом использоваться пациентами со втянутой стомой. Благодаря высоким абсорбирующим свойствам, пластина отлично защищает кожу от агрессивного влияния кишечного отделяемого. Плавающий фланец системы дает возможность менять емкости, не удаляя пластину. Из-за этого срок службы пластины Fleаxwear значительно возрастает.

!Фланец пластин должен соответствовать фланцу мешков!

Размер: вырезаемое отверстие 13-40 мм

Количество в упаковке: 5 шт

ПРОДАЮТСЯ ТОЛЬКО УПАКОВКОЙ! стоимость указана за упаковку.
